Are Sea-Doo boats still made?

Sea-Doo is a Canadian brand of personal watercraft (PWC) and boats manufactured by Bombardier Recreational Products (BRP). All Sea-Doo models are driven by an impeller-driven waterjet. All Sea-Doo PWC models are currently produced at BRP’s plants in Querétaro and Juárez, Mexico.

Do jet boats use more fuel?

Jet boat motors operate at higher RPMs. This makes them less fuel-efficient. However, don’t get it wrong, every engine and each boat is somewhat different, so that they aren’t all horrible with fuel consumption, but they have a tendency of being among the least fuel-efficient types of water vessels.

Are Sea Doos reliable?

Contrary to popular belief, Sea-Doos are not unreliable. However, they do feature more complex systems than competitor models, and these require more attention and care. Because of this, Sea-Doos are often considered to be like German luxury cars, which are high maintenance but offer an outstanding driving experience.

Is there a Sea-Doo shortage?

Yes. BRP’s supply chain continues to be impacted by two factors during the pandemic: rising raw material costs and increased shipping costs. Because of rising costs, BRP has put in place a commodity surcharge for Sea-Doo, Ski-Doo, Lynx, Can-Am Off-Road and Can-Am On-Road vehicles.

How fast does a Sea Doo jet boat go?

Sea Doo top speeds tend to vary depending on the model, with the slowest being around 40 mph, and the fastest topping out around 70 mph.

What is the fastest Sea-Doo boat?

RXP-X 300 the Fastest Sea-Doo

With a manufacturing speed limit of 67 mph, the RXP-X-300 is able to reach an astounding speed of 70 mph depending on conditions.

How fast does a 300 hp Sea-Doo go?

When it comes to the Sea-Doo RXT-X 300, you can expect 67 mph top speeds and extreme acceleration. This model is powered with a 1630cc, 4-stroke, 3-cylinder, supercharged Rotax engine, which offers not less than 300 HP.

Is a Sea-Doo spark worth buying?

Sea-Doo Sparks are amazing and unique watercrafts, but they are definitely not for everybody. These PWCs have small and nimble hulls, and really affordable price tags. On the other hand, Sparks have a really limited storage and weight capacity, and their performance is moderate.

Do Seadoos hold their value?

The cost of used jet skis could vary considerably based on features and how much the previous owner used them on the water. Statistics show that jet skis depreciate by 22 percent in the first year after having been purchased from a new dealer, and then eight percent per year after that.

Can you leave your jet ski in the water overnight?

Yes, you can leave a jet ski in the water overnight if it’s unavoidable. Alternatively, it’s not recommended you leave it in the water for a longer period, as it may incur different form of damage! That’s why every owner’s manual recommends you remove the jet ski from the water every day.

Is 100 hours a lot on a jet ski?

As a general rule to go by, a jet ski with more than 100 hours is considered a high hour jet ski. On average a jet ski should have approximately 30 hours a year. Anything more than 30 hours per year is considered “high hours”.
